新米iPhoneアプリ開発者(自称)の開発奮闘記

iPhoneアプリ開発(自称)3ヶ月目の悪戦苦闘を記して行きます。

Trixboxのconf ファイル

extensions.conf
Trixboxが更新するファイルなので勝手にいじってはいけない。

extensions_additional.conf
IVRの設定とか特殊番号の設定が書かれているようだ。これも人間が勝手にいじってはいけない。

extensions_custom.conf
extensions.confの注釈にこう書いてある。

Customizations to this dialplan should be made in extensions_custom.conf
See extensions_custom.conf. sample for an example.
if you need to use [macro-dialout-trunk-predial-hook], [ext-did-custom], or
[from-internal-custom] for example, place these in this file or they will get overwritten.


Asteriskとちがってちょっとカスタマイズしたいだけなのに、confファイルの構造がちょっと
特殊なので、Asterisk本とかAsteriskのWebの情報そのまま追記すればいいってもんではないんです。
sip.conf とか extension.conf はTrixboxが自動修正するので勝手にカスタマイズするとその内容が消えてしまう
ので、 ~_custom.confの方に追記しなければいけなかったりするんだけど、
じゃあその~_custom.confで書き込まれた内容はどうすれば読み込まれるのか、どうすれば認識されるのか
よくわからないんです。
純粋なAsterisk使うようにしようかなあ。